Cason Jay Cooley (born November 28, 1978, in Akron, Ohio) is an American record producer, audio engineer, composer, songwriter, and musician. He was raised in Wichita, Kansas.{{Cite web|title = Cason Cooley - Producer |url = http://www.secretroad.com/writers-and-producers/cason-cooley-producer|website = Secretroad.com|access-date = 2016-02-24}} As a child, Cooley often accompanied his parents, who toured the country as a part of the Cathedral Quartet.
